If standard medications fail to deliver the relief you expected, medical experts will recommend one of three options:

  1. ketamine

  2. electroconvulsive therapy (ECT)

  3. transcranial magnetic stimulation (TMS)

Ketamine is the most effective of the three, followed by ECT and then TMS.*

Ketamine works quickly for depression and the results are lasting with the proper mental health plan.

Ketamine can be delivered by infusion (IV), intramuscular injection (IM), oral absorption (troches or tablets), and nasal spray (ketamine or es-ketamine).
